Abstract P1030: Role of Hypertension in the Cardiovascular-Kidney-Metabolic Syndrome among Black Adults: The Jackson Heart Study
Abstract
Introduction: CKM consists of obesity, metabolic risk factors, chronic kidney disease (CKD) and cardiovascular disease (CVD). Hypertension is a key factor for stage 2 CKM and it is most common among Black adults. A better understanding of the role of hypertension in CKM progression is needed. Aim: To estimate the risk of progression to stage 4 CKM in Black adults, overall and among those with hypertension, in the Jackson Heart Study (JHS). Methods: We included 2,118 Black adults in the JHS without clinical CVD at baseline. Participants were categorized into: Stage 1 CKM: overweight/obesity, abdominal obesity or dysfunctional adipose tissue with no metabolic risk factors including hypertension; Stage 2 CKM: metabolic risk factors including hypertension, diabetes, hypertriglyceridemia, metabolic syndrome or CKD; Stage 3 CKM: subclinical CVD; or Stage 4 CKM: Clinical CVD. The incidence rate of stage 4 CKM for participants in stages 1, 2 and 3 CKM were estimated. We used Cox proportional hazards regression to estimate hazard ratios (HRs) for incident stage 4 CKM. Results: At baseline, 20%, 69%, and 11% of participants were in stages 1, 2 and 3 CKM. The prevalence of hypertension in stage 2 CKM and stage 3 CKM were 80% and 95%, respectively. The incidence rate per 1,000 person-years of stage 4 CKM for participants with stage 2 CKM and hypertension was 7.5 (95% CI 6.1, 8.9), and for stage 3 CKM and hypertension was 26.6 (95% CI 19.8, 33.3) ( Table ). The adjusted HRs of developing stage 4 CKM were 3.25 (95%CI: 1.56-6.80) and 5.11 (95% CI 2.05-12.78) for participants with stage 2 and 3 CKM with hypertension versus stage 1 CKM, respectively. Conclusion: The majority of JHS participants with stages 2 and 3 CKM had hypertension, which was associated with an increased risk for progressing to stage 4 CKM when compared to stage 1 CKM participants.
